SDCL § 43-23-4.1: Legal fences for buffalo.

A legal fence for buffalo is the same as provided in § 43-23-4, except as provided in this section. A legal fence for buffalo may use smooth wire rather than barbed wire. All posts shall be of sufficient length to provide for fifty-four inches above the surface, and one additional strand of wire shall be included at fifty-four inches above the earth. The additional cost and maintenance of the legal fence for buffalo, other than an as provided in § 43-23-4, shall be borne by the owner or caretaker of the buffalo if only one of the parties partitioned possesses the buffalo.
